  • Melamine - Wikipedia
    Melamine ˈmɛləmiːn ⓘ is an organic compound with the formula C 3 H 6 N 6 This white solid is a trimer of cyanamide, with a 1,3,5-triazine skeleton Like cyanamide, it contains 66% nitrogen by mass, and its derivatives have fire-retardant properties due to its release of nitrogen gas when burned or charred

  • Melamine | C3N3 (NH2)3 | CID 7955 - PubChem
    Melamine is an organic base and a trimer of cyanamide, with a 1,3,5-triazine skeleton Like cyanamide, it contains 66% nitrogen by mass and, if mixed with resins, has fire retardant properties due to its release of nitrogen gas when burned or charred, and has several other industrial uses
